Atlanta Hawks vs Philadelphia 76ers game thread

The Atlanta Hawks hit the road for a rare Saturday mid-day matchup against the Philadelphia 76ers.

The Atlanta Hawks used a strong fourth quarter to snap a four-game losing streak in season openers with a 114-99 win over the Washington Wizards. They will look for a more balanced effort on Saturday when they face off against the Philadelphia 76ers in a rare mid-day start.

The Sixers are an intriguing team especially with center Joel Embiid healthy and on the court. Embiid scored 20 points in his season debut but is on a minutes restriction so don't expect to see him for more than 20-25 minutes of action. Sergio Rodriguez also had a nice debut for the Sixers finishing with 12 points and nine assists with no turnovers in Wednesday's loss to the Thunder. So keep an eye on the matchup between Rodriguez and Dennis Schröder this afternoon as well.

Injury Report:

Atlanta - Mike Scott (knee) and Tiago Splitter (hamstring) are out.

Philadelphia - Jerryd Bayless (left wrist), Nerlens Noel (knee), Ben Simmons (foot) are out.
